Tyler Chardonnay Santa Barbara County 2023 presents a vibrant flavor profile characterized by notes of citrus, green apple, and subtle oak. This wine is sourced from the esteemed Santa Barbara County region, known for its diverse microclimates that enhance the Chardonnay's natural acidity and complexity.
For optimal enjoyment, serve it chilled at a temperature of 50-55°F. This Chardonnay pairs well with seafood, poultry, and creamy dishes, making it a versatile choice for various culinary occasions. Consider decanting briefly to enhance its aromatic profile.

"The 2023 Chardonnay (Santa Barbara County) is classic Santa Barbara all the way, with bright yellow fruits, flickers of spice and inner creaminess, all articulated without any extra weight. Clean and precise, there's an extra measure of minerality here that is quite a pleasant surprise for an entry-level wine."
"The 2023 Chardonnay opens with beautifully pure, fresh aromas of jasmine, citrus rinds and orchard blossoms. On the palate, it displays a live-wire, tangy energy that carries through the zesty, mineral-drenched finish. This punches far above its weight and would do so as an appellation wine, much less a regional one."
